All you need is to follow the steps and you are going to have eyes that will really stand out.

Step # 1: Prepare the eye area.

Always check the area around your eyes. You have to see if you've got puffy, dry and dark circle areas. Puffiness can be treated with cold packs perhaps around eight to ten minutes will do. Moisturizers and eye creams will do the trick of putting away the dryness. You can brighten your eyes by applying concealer under and around your eyes. This should be enough to prepare your eyes.

Step #2: Beautify your brows

If you want to make a striking brow, do not fall for fashion trend traps. However there are really a lot of ways to make your eyebrows strikingly different. You can shape your brows according to the natural growth pattern that you already have. Do not go for sharp angular brows. Instead go for that gentle arch which will make you look gentle and caring. Use an eyebrow brush to smoothen the hair along with dark brown or black powder. Do not use the eyebrow pencils because they never look so natural at all. However you can use them at night for that dramatic look you want.

Step #3: Learn your appropriate colors

Obviously, you don't use all eye shadow colors at the same time. You have to be careful when you choose the appropriate color for you. Remember to only use two colors within the same family of color. You can be allowed to use three during the night but more often than not, two colors will do just fine. Darker colors should be applied first on the lid then will be blended upwards. Light colors are best for the subtle look on the brow bone and outer eye areas. In addition, an extra color can be used at night to be the natural shimmering look.
